Strategy Tips

tee shot

Position your tee shot in the 200-250 yard range where the fairway maintains a consistent 36-yard width, giving you optimal angle and distance control for your approach.

approach

Plan for a mid-to-short iron approach shot from the ideal landing zone, as you'll have roughly 110-160 yards remaining to a generous 4,928 square foot green.

hazard warning

Be aware of bunkers positioned at 326 yards - while likely not in play for most golfers on this 362-yard hole, longer hitters should avoid over-swinging to stay clear of trouble.

green

Target the center of this rectangular 22x33 yard green, as its substantial size provides forgiveness for approach shots that may be slightly off-target.

tee shot

This manageable 362-yard par 4 rewards accuracy over distance - focus on finding the fairway rather than trying to drive as close to the green as possible.
